The Swank MS Foundation is a 501(c)(3) private charity that provides information and resources on the Swank Low Fat Diet, vitamin supplements, and life-style changes beneficial to patients with Multiple Sclerosis, as well as their families and friends, as pioneered by Roy L. Swank, M.D., Ph.D.

QUICK REFERENCE 

  1. No processed foods containing saturated fat and/or hydrogenated oils.

  2. Saturated fat should not exceed 15 grams per day. Unsaturated fat (oils) should be kept to 20-50 grams/day.

  3. Fruits and vegetables are permissible in any amount.

  4. No red meat for the first year, including pork. After the first year, 3 oz. of red meat is allowed once per week.

  5. White-meat poultry (skinless) and white fish are permissible, but avoid dark-meat poultry and limit fatty fish to 50 grams (1.75 oz)/day.

  6. Dairy products must contain 1% or less butterfat unless otherwise noted. Use egg whites only, no yolks.

  7. Cod liver oil (1 tsp. or equivalent capsules) and a multi-vitamin and mineral supplement are recommended daily.

  8. Whole-grain breads, rice, and pastas are encouraged.

  9. Daily snacks of nuts & seeds are good sources of natural oil, and help maintain a good energy level.
